IPL 2024: “Their squad is full and their replacements are full”- Irfan Pathan analyzes CSK’s squad ahead of the IPL 2024

Irfan Pathan, a former cricket player, provided a review of CSK’s team for the 2024 Indian Premier League recognizing that CSK has effectively addressed each aspect. His analysis clarifies the squad’s complex dynamics as they prepare for the upcoming IPL season with the goal of winning another title.

The legendary MS Dhoni-led Chennai Super Kings (CSK) will go into the competition as the reigning champions, having won their fifth IPL title in the IPL 2023 final against the Gujarat Titans (GT). With this victory, CSK and MI are now the two most successful teams in IPL history. Twelve of the fourteen seasons in which they have competed have seen them advance to the knockout stages.

“They have not one but two combinations ready well before the IPL season has started” – Irfan Pathan on CSK

Irfan Pathan was questioned if the Chennai Super Kings’ auction purchases have made their squad even stronger during a Star Sports discussion. He reacted:

“In terms of the combination they have, their playing XI is sorted. Apart from the playing XI, they have five or six guys who can actually come and play as well. So their squad is full and their replacements are full.”

Irfan Pathan stated that if Matheesha Pathirana does not start well, they will have Mustafizur Rahman along with possibly all Indian bowlers as well as the vast majority of overseas batters.

Mustafizur Rahman was purchased by CSK at the auction for ₹2 crore. Their bowling lineup will be further strengthened by the possible return of Mukesh Choudhary, who was sidelined by injury throughout the previous season.

“If Matheesha Pathirana doesn’t start well, they have Mustafizur Rahman. They might even start with Mustafizur. They might have all Indian bowlers and most of the overseas batters as well. So they have not one but two combinations ready well before the IPL season has started,” Pathan further added.

“You don’t have many Indian batters who can actually replace him” – Irfan Pathan on replacement of Ambati Rayudu

It was unlikely that the Chennai Super Kings would find the perfect Ambati Rayudu successor, according to Irfan Pathan. He reasoned:

“We were talking about what the Chennai Super Kings were going to do, especially with Ambati Rayudu, because if a player like Ambati Rayudu goes away, you don’t have many Indian batters who can actually replace him.”

The former cricket player turned commentator continued, saying that Rayudu’s absence has been compensated for by the addition of Shardul Thakur, an Indian bowler, and Daryl Mitchell, a foreign batter.

“So what you needed to do was to get Daryl Mitchell, an overseas guy, and get one Indian fast bowler as well. They exactly did the same thing. They got Daryl Mitchell and they got Shardul Thakur also,” he stated.

The Chennai-based team bought Mitchell at the auction last year for an incredible ₹14 crore. Considering that the Indian all-rounder was acquired by the Delhi Capitals (DC) for ₹10.75 crore and later traded to the Kolkata Knight Riders (KKR) for the same amount, they acquired Shardul for a comparatively low price of ₹4 crore.
